深入了解区块链技术:的科普解读
引言
近年来,区块链技术成为科技领域的一个热词,越来越多的人开始关注这一技术。然而,许多初学者对区块链的概念、原理以及应用领域仍然感到困惑。本文旨在通过的语言,深入浅出地讲解区块链技术,帮助读者理解其基本理念及潜在价值。
区块链是什么
区块链是一种分布式账本技术,是通过加密算法和共识机制实现数据的透明、安全和不可篡改的分布式数据库。简单来说,所有的交易和数据记录都被以“区块”的形式存储,通过“链”将这些区块连接在一起,从而形成一个完整的链条。这种结构使得数据的存储和传输具有高度的安全性和可追溯性。
区块链的核心特性包括去中心化、透明性、不可篡改性和安全性。去中心化是指数据不再由单一的中心机构掌控,而是分布在网络中的每一个节点上。这使得任何人都可以参与到数据的验证和记录中,提高了系统的安全性和可信度。透明性保障了所有参与者都可以看到数据的变化和交易的全过程,而不可篡改性则确保了既有数据无法被恶意修改。
区块链的工作原理
区块链的工作原理可以简单概括为数据记录、广播、验证和保存四个步骤。当一笔新的交易发生时,该交易信息会被打包成一个“区块”。然后,这个区块会被广播到网络中所有的节点。每个节点会对收到的区块进行验证,确保其合法性和正确性。验证通过后,区块就被添加到已有的区块链上,形成新的交易记录。
为了保证区块的合法性与交易的安全性,区块链使用了许多不同的共识机制,例如工作量证明(PoW)、权益证明(PoS)等。这些机制帮助网络中的节点达成一致意见,保证每个区块都是有效的。同时,区块链还使用加密算法来保障用户的隐私和安全性,确保数据在传输过程中不会被窃取或篡改。
区块链的应用领域
区块链技术的应用领域非常广泛,涵盖了金融、供应链管理、身份认证、数字版权、医疗健康等多个行业。在金融领域,区块链为数字货币(如比特币)提供了基础支持,使得交易更加快捷安全。此外,利用智能合约技术,区块链可以自动化执行合约条款,降低交易成本和时间。
在供应链管理中,区块链可以实现对产品从生产到销售的全程追踪,确保商品的源头可追溯并提高透明度。这在农产品、药品等领域尤其重要,可以有效打击假冒伪劣商品。在身份认证方面,区块链可以为个人和企业提供数字身份解决方案,防止身份盗用与诈骗。
医疗健康领域也在逐渐采用区块链技术用于病历管理、药品流通追踪等,确保数据的安全性和患者的隐私。通过这些应用,可以大大提升传统行业的效率,减少成本及人为错误。
常见问题解答
什么是智能合约?
智能合约是区块链技术的一个重要组成部分,它是自动执行、控制或文档化法律相关事件和行动的合约。智能合约不仅包括合约的条款和条件,而且还能够在条件满足时自动执行合约,减少人为干预,从而提高效率和减少交易成本。
智能合约一般运行在区块链网络上,自身的代码确保了合约的执行过程是透明和可追溯的,避免了垄断和欺诈的发生。通过智能合约,当用户或企业满足设定条件时,可以自动触发相应的行为。例如,在房地产交易中,买者支付房款,智能合约会自动将房产转移到买者名下,整个过程无需传统中介介入,节省了时间和金钱。
智能合约的广泛应用代表区块链技术在商业领域的一次重大创新,然而,也有一些挑战需要克服,例如代码错误、法律法规的更新等。因此,在设计和实施智能合约时,必须保持谨慎与周全,确保合约的安全性与可靠性。
区块链的安全性如何保障?
区块链的安全性主要体现在其数据结构和共识机制两方面。区块链采用了哈希算法对每一个区块进行加密,上一个区块的哈希值被包含在下一个区块中,确保了数据的不可篡改性。当数据一旦写入区块链后,篡改任何一个区块都需要同时修改所有后续的区块,这在实际操作中几乎是不可能完成的,这也是区块链安全的根本原因之一。
此外,各种共识机制(如工作量证明、权益证明等)也在一定程度上提高了区块链系统的安全性。这些机制通过要求区块链网络中的节点共同进行计算与验证,提高了进入网络的门槛,减少恶意节点的存在可能性。
随着技术的发展,黑客攻击或系统故障造成的安全隐患依然存在。在设计区块链系统时,需要考虑多层次的安全架构,从而最大程度上降低潜在的风险。此外,增强用户教育,提高安全意识也能对区块链应用的安全性起到积极作用。
区块链技术的未来发展趋势是什么?
区块链技术的未来发展趋势非常广阔,主要体现在以下几个方面:第一,跨链技术的发展。不同的区块链之间的互操作性将成为重要的发展方向,跨链技术将推动区块链在各个领域的应用更加广泛和深入。通过实现跨链交易,用户可以在不同的区块链平台之间无缝流转资产,提高区块链的便利性和灵活性。
第二,区块链与人工智能和物联网的结合。随着这三项技术的成熟,区块链成为IoT和AI的基础设施,为其提供安全、透明和去中心化的服务。例如,利用区块链技术,可以加强物联网设备之间的通信安全性;而在AI领域,区块链可以帮助训练和验证算法的数据完整性和安全性。
第三,监管合规性逐渐得到重视。随着区块链技术和数字货币的普及,政府和监管机构对区块链技术的监管力度也在加强。合规性和安全性将成为区块链发展的重要因素,如何在创新与监管之间找到平衡是未来的重要挑战。
最后,区块链技术的社区建设和生态系统的完善也将是未来发展的焦点。6591各大企业和机构将联合开发和应用区块链技术,形成良性循环,共同推动行业的发展。
总结
区块链技术作为一种创新的分布式账本技术,正在改变我们对数据存储和管理的传统观念。通过去中心化、透明性和不可篡改性,区块链为多个行业带来了革命性的变化。从金融业到供应链管理,从身份认证到医疗健康,区块链都在为经济和社会的发展提供新的解决方案。
我们生活在一个数字化迅猛发展的时代,掌握区块链技术的基本概念与应用前景无疑是非常必要的。虽然区块链技术仍在不断发展,但它的潜力已经展现。只有深入了解这项技术,我们才能更好地应对未来的变化与挑战。
希望本文能帮助读者更好地理解区块链技术的原理、应用以及发展趋势,鼓励大家积极探索这一领域的无限可能。